The prints originate from the 1842 publication 'Der Rittersaal: Eine Geschichte des Ritterthums', a celebrated work by Friedrich Martin von Reibisch with historical commentary by Dr. Franz Kottenkamp. These pieces serve as a remarkable testament to the craftsmanship and functionality of European medieval weaponry. The left panel presents a diverse assortment of weapons, including clubs, maces with chain links, halberds, and ornamental spears adorned with red tassels. Each piece is rendered with fine attention to detail, showcasing the decorative flourishes and sturdy construction of these instruments of war. The right panel focuses on an impressive lineup of halberds and poleaxes, weapons prized for their versatility in battle. The various forms of axe blades, hooks, and spikes demonstrate the ingenuity of medieval blacksmiths in crafting weapons suited for piercing, chopping, and grappling opponents in combat. The hand-applied coloring enhances the visual appeal, with careful shading that highlights the wood grain of the shafts and the polished sheen of the metal heads.
